Factors Influencing Lawyer Consultation Fees in the Philippines

Lawyer consultation fees in the Philippines can vary significantly depending on several factors. Let’s explore some of the key elements that influence these costs:

1. Lawyer’s Experience and Expertise : Highly experienced lawyers or those with specialized knowledge in a particular legal field tend to command higher consultation fees. Their in-depth understanding and track record often justify the premium rates.

2. Complexity of the Legal Matter : The nature and intricacy of the legal issue at hand play a crucial role in determining the consultation fee. More complex cases often require extensive research, preparation, and strategic planning, leading to higher costs.

3. Location and Prestige of the Law Firm : Lawyers practicing in major cities or highly reputable law firms may charge higher consultation fees due to their overhead costs, reputation, and the caliber of services they offer.

4. Hourly vs. Flat Rate Fees : Some lawyers charge an hourly rate for their consultations, while others prefer a flat rate. The choice between these fee structures can significantly impact the overall cost, particularly for more time-consuming cases.

5. Additional Costs and Expenses : Beyond the consultation fee itself, clients may need to account for additional expenses such as court filing fees, document preparation costs, and other legal-related expenses.

Average Lawyer Consultation Fees Across Different Practice Areas

To provide a better understanding, let’s explore the average lawyer consultation fees across different practice areas in the Philippines:

  • Corporate and Business Law : Lawyers specializing in corporate and business law often charge higher consultation fees due to the complexity of legal matters involved. Rates can range from PHP 5,000 to PHP 15,000 or more, depending on the lawyer’s experience and the firm’s reputation.
  • Family Law (Divorce, Child Custody, etc.) : For family law matters, such as divorce or child custody cases, consultation fees typically fall between PHP 3,000 and PHP 8,000, with variations based on the case’s complexity and the lawyer’s expertise.
  • Criminal Defense : Consultation fees for criminal defense lawyers can vary significantly, ranging from PHP 2,000 to PHP 10,000 or more, depending on the severity of the case and the lawyer’s reputation.
  • Real Estate and Property Law : Lawyers dealing with real estate and property law matters typically charge consultation fees between PHP 4,000 and PHP 10,000, with higher rates for more complex transactions or disputes.
  • Personal Injury and Accident Cases : For personal injury or accident cases, consultation fees can range from PHP 3,000 to PHP 8,000, with some lawyers offering contingency fee arrangements, where they only get paid if the case is successful.
  • Immigration Law : Consultation fees for immigration lawyers can range from PHP 2,500 to PHP 7,000, depending on the specific immigration matter and the lawyer’s experience.

It’s important to note that these ranges are estimates, and actual fees may vary based on the individual lawyer or law firm.

Strategies to Minimize Legal Consultation Costs

While legal consultations can be expensive, there are several strategies you can consider to minimize the costs:

  1. Initial Consultation Offers and Discounts : Many lawyers and law firms offer discounted or even free initial consultations to attract new clients. Take advantage of these offers to get a better understanding of your legal matter and the potential costs involved.
  2. Legal Aid and Pro Bono Services : If you have limited financial means, consider exploring legal aid organizations or pro bono services offered by law firms. These services provide free or low-cost legal assistance to individuals who meet certain eligibility criteria.
  3. Negotiating Fees with Your Lawyer : Don’t be afraid to negotiate the consultation fee with your lawyer, especially if you’re facing financial constraints. Many lawyers are open to discussing fee arrangements and may be willing to offer discounts or payment plans.
  4. Considering Alternative Dispute Resolution Methods : In certain cases, alternative dispute resolution methods, such as mediation or arbitration, can be more cost-effective than traditional legal proceedings. Explore these options with your lawyer to potentially reduce overall legal expenses.
  5. Doing Preliminary Research and Preparation : Before consulting a lawyer, do your own research and gather relevant documents and information. This can help streamline the consultation process and potentially reduce the time and costs involved.
